"We have a plan!!"

So the cry from the Kerry/Edwards campaign goes! Yes, in deed, they have a plan. Unfortunately no one really knows what it is. There are the "Four Points". From the Kerry website, here they are:

===============

Internationalize, because others must share the burden.

Train Iraqis, because they must be responsible for their own security.

Move forward with reconstruction because that's an important way to stop the spread of terror.

Help Iraqis achieve a viable government, because it is up to them to run their own country.

===============

A couple of thoughts on this "plan for winning the peace".

Internationalize the effort: Senator Kerry, today, had to admit that the chance of France and Germany contributing troops to the efforts were zero. And, with NATO already heavily involved in Afghanistan, the probably of additional troops from that organization is likewise doubtful. Of course, there is our current coalition of the "bribed and coerced" we could look to. However, that smoke you see in the distance are the bridges that Senator Kerry is in the process of burning. Our primary resource for fighting troops are the Iraqi people themselves. It would behoove Senators Kerry and Edwards to acknowledge their incredible sacrifice and their courage in this undertaking. The internationalization process is a dead end.
